GPS and Geolocation as Foundational Tech
At the heart of dynamic local discovery lies Global Positioning System (GPS) technology, complemented by various geolocation methods. GPS, a satellite-based navigation system, provides precise location and time information anywhere on Earth. While initially developed for military applications, its liberalization for civilian use fundamentally changed how we interact with our environment.
However, GPS isn’t the sole player. In urban environments or indoors where satellite signals can be obstructed, technologies like Wi-Fi triangulation and cellular tower triangulation fill the gap. Wi-Fi triangulation leverages the known locations of Wi-Fi hotspots to estimate a device’s position, while cellular triangulation uses signals from multiple cell towers. These diverse methods work in concert, often seamlessly blended by modern devices and apps, to ensure a consistently accurate understanding of a user’s location. For developers, access to sophisticated geolocation APIs (Application Programming Interfaces) means they can easily integrate these powerful capabilities into their applications, enabling features ranging from hyper-local event notifications to real-time ride-sharing services. This foundational technology is critical, as without an accurate “where am I?”, the “what’s near me?” question remains unanswerable.

Natural Language Processing (NLP) for Enhanced Search

The way we interact with technology is becoming more natural, thanks to advancements in Natural Language Processing (NLP). Voice assistants like Siri, Google Assistant, and Amazon Alexa are increasingly capable of understanding complex, conversational queries. Instead of typing “restaurants near me,” you can simply ask, “Hey Google, what’s a good Italian restaurant nearby that’s open late and has vegetarian options?” NLP allows the system to parse this nuanced request, extract key entities and constraints, and deliver highly relevant results. This makes local discovery more accessible and seamless, especially when on the go, removing the friction of typing and navigating menus. Semantic search capabilities, which understand the meaning behind words rather than just keyword matches, further refine this process, leading to more accurate and insightful responses.

Best Practices for Users
Empowering users to manage their digital footprint is crucial. Several best practices can help individuals enjoy the benefits of local discovery while mitigating privacy risks:
- Understand App Permissions: Before installing or updating an app, carefully review the permissions it requests. Does a flashlight app genuinely need access to your location or microphone? Grant only the permissions absolutely necessary for the app’s core functionality.
- Manage Location Services Settings: Operating systems (iOS, Android) offer granular control over location access. You can choose to allow location access “Always,” “While Using the App,” “Ask Next Time,” or “Never.” Opting for “While Using the App” or “Ask Next Time” for most services is a good balance between functionality and privacy.
- Review Privacy Policies: While often lengthy, privacy policies explain how your data is collected, used, and shared. Familiarizing yourself with these (or at least skimming key sections) helps you understand what you’re consenting to.
- Regularly Review Activity History: Many platforms allow you to review and delete your location history, search history, and activity data. Periodically cleaning this data can limit the long-term profile building by these services.
- Use Privacy-Focused Alternatives: Where available and practical, explore apps and services that prioritize user privacy and offer more transparent data handling practices.
Developer Responsibilities and Ethical AI
The responsibility for privacy and security doesn’t solely rest with the user; developers and companies behind these technologies bear a significant ethical and legal burden. Ethical AI development demands:
- Secure Data Handling: Implementing robust encryption, access controls, and cybersecurity measures to protect user data from breaches and unauthorized access.
- Transparency: Clearly communicating to users what data is collected, why it’s collected, how it’s used, and with whom it might be shared. This includes making privacy policies understandable and accessible.
- Data Anonymization and Aggregation: Where possible, processing data in an anonymized or aggregated form to glean insights without identifying individual users.
- User Control: Providing users with easy-to-use tools to manage their data, revoke consent, correct inaccuracies, and delete their information.
- Minimizing Data Collection: Adhering to the principle of data minimization, only collecting data that is absolutely necessary for the service to function effectively.
Building trust through transparent and responsible data practices is paramount for the continued success and acceptance of sophisticated local discovery technologies.

Outdoor and Adventure Tech
For outdoor enthusiasts, technology has opened up a world of possibilities. Apps like AllTrails provide detailed maps of hiking, biking, and running trails, complete with user reviews, difficulty ratings, and photos. Cyclists use apps like Strava to discover routes, track performance, and connect with local cycling communities. Stargazing apps use AR and GPS to identify constellations and planets visible from your current location. Geocaching apps turn local exploration into a treasure hunt. Many of these integrate with wearables like smartwatches, offering real-time data, navigation cues, and health metrics, making every outdoor adventure safer and more informed.
